Output 95b52a2ce64bc75949eeaa97e143af5242e786ed8c347961dc2492244961838c:1

value
935745
script pubkey
OP_0 OP_PUSHBYTES_32 52d9d362763543e62e6ed90dd9c5b8c2f3bb8a2e90573344b3bd3c29f6954971
address
bc1q2tvaxcnkx4p7vtnwmyxan3dcctemhz3wjptnx39nh57zna54f9cszfyk4l
transaction
95b52a2ce64bc75949eeaa97e143af5242e786ed8c347961dc2492244961838c
spent
true